Overview Walter P Moore is an international company of engineers, architects, innovators, and creative people who solve some of the world’s most complex structural and infrastructure challenges.
Providing structural, diagnostics, civil, traffic, parking, transportation, enclosure, WPM technology and construction engineering services, we design solutions that are cost‑and‑resource‑efficient, forward‑thinking, and help support and shape communities worldwide.
Founded in 1931 and headquartered in Houston, Texas, our 1000+ professionals work across 26 U.
S. offices and 8 international locations.
